On January 27th, 2016, Mayor Bao Nguyen, the nation’s first Vietnamese American mayor of a city with a population of more than 100,000, addressed the citizens of Garden Grove about exciting new develop projects currently underway in the city.

Great Wolf Lodge: The largest family of indoor water parks with hotels is set to make a splash in the city of Garden Grove on February 19, 2016! The Great Wolf Lodge Southern California is a unique and attractive project that is scheduled to open next month. The property boasts of 603 suites, a water park, seven restaurants, a bowling alley, a spa for girls and an interactive scavenger hunt. When fully operational, this property will employ 750 people. It is estimated the resort will bring in about $8 million dollars annually in tax revenue, the most of any hotel in Garden Grove.

Christ Cathedral: Restoration is underway to turn the 35-acre campus into a center of Catholic life that blends both traditional design elements and modern architecture. Plans for phase one of the restoration, took a year to develop, and includes panels that partially shade the glass cathedral. A recreational lawn is being planned at the corner of Chapman Avenue and Lewis Street to hold 6,000 to 8,000 people for outdoor mass. When completed, this will be the second largest Roman Catholic facility after the Vatican.
